Growing up in a family business that was advertising and a community paper was and is a mixed blessing.
Our lives revolved around the work. The people and the product and the communities that we were responsible for serving.
Often our thoughts our needs took second fiddle to the jobs we needed to perform for our communities.
We provided an alternative affordable place for people to advertise business, things, events and whatever other information our community wanted to communicate to others in a large way.
While in school at a young age learning about the science of advertising and marketing, I connected with the phrase consider the force.
As my teacher taught about manipulation of delivery of advertising I took paused contemplating what I was learning to what role my family and our business took in the world of information and influence.
My evaluation of our business and product continued to be of service for many years within our communities.

In our current time in history I have become prouder and more aware of the service our company provided. Often working with a wide range of our communities. we interacted and represented a wide array of demographics. Our customers and readers represented most of our communities population ranging from some of the most finically desperate to some of the most affluent.
We prided ourselves on our price sheet and the fact that it was not variable. Consistently was clear for decades and decades.
We priced our products appropriately to cover our expenditures but not so high that it wasn’t available to some who had financial limitations.
Our business also was a consistency that our communities came to trust for information.
As our business our communities and census of the data determined it was time to pivot to additional services and discontinue others became clear that the world changed.
Our original mission method and madness that we had done for decades of deadlines decisions and determination that we too could not carry on in the current atmosphere of information sharing.
